About the author

Called a "preaching genius" by CNN, Fred Craddock (1928-2015) was Bandy Distinguished Professor of Preaching and New Testament, emeritus, at Candler School of Theology, Emory University, and minister emeritus of Cherry Log Christian Church (Disciples of Christ). He was a sought-after lecturer, an author of several books, and a captivating storyteller.
